 * Hi there,
 * my site (siluofake.com) worked fluently. About one month ago, when I was installing
   another site, I deleted a mysql database by accident!
    Now when I try to open
   my site ([http://siluofake.com](http://siluofake.com)), I got the following error
   message (google translate from Chinese): “Error in creating database connection”.
   And when I want to open “[http://siluofake.com/wp-admin/&#8221](http://siluofake.com/wp-admin/&#8221);
   I got the following error message:
 * “Can not select database
 * We were able to connect to the database server (which means that your username
   and password are correct) but failed to select the $s database.
 * 1. Are you sure it exists?
    2. Does the user veryeuro_europe1 have permission
   to use the database veryeuro_cinask? 3. In some systems your database name prefix
   is your username, in the case of username_veryeuro_cinask. Could this be the 
   problem? ”
 * Is there any way to recover a deleted mysql database through cpanel? Thank you
   very much.

 * You should login to your host’s cPanel and check whether the user `veryeuro_europe1`
   is connected to the database in question, and that the database exists, and if
   it has all access privileges.
